GUWAHATI: Jorhat is the 12th Lok Sabha constituency in Assam and is one of the key constituencies for the upcoming Lok Sabha elections in the State. 

Two communities, the Ahoms and the Tea tribes have played a major role in electing the next Member of Parliament from this constituency.

Congress has always had a strong presence in this constituency for decades. The Party had won the Lok Sabha elections from here at least 12 times. It lost once to Asom Gana Parishad's (AGP) Parag Chaliha in 1984 and then again to BJP's Kamakhya Prasad Tasa in 2014.

Even Former Assam Chief Minister, Tarun Gogoi won the seat twice in 1971 and 1977.   

In an interesting turnaround, during the 2009 Lok Sabha elections, veteran Congress leader, late Bijoy Krishna Handique won the seat against Tasa with a vote margin of 290, 406 and the tables turned and how, during the 2014 Lok Sabha elections where Kamakhya Prasad Tasa defeated Handique with a margin of 102, 420 votes.

After Bijoy Krishna Handique passed away in 2015, questions arose regarding who the party would field for the seat for the next elections.

Last month, the Congress Election Committee announced that former Thowra MLA, Sushanta Borgohain would be contesting for the poll. Although veteran leader and Former Assam Chief Minister, Tarun Gogoi was not in favour of Borghain as Lok Sabha candidate from Jorhat, the party still decided to go with him.

While it was expected that sitting MP Kamakhya Prasad Tasa would be contesting to retain the seat, BJP high command decided to field Assam Power Minister and Sonari MLA, Topon Kumar Gogoi for the seat.

CONSTITUENCY DETAILS:

DAY OF POLLING: 11TH APRIL

POLLING STATIONS:  1753

TOTAL VOTERS:  1,433,900

MALE VOTERS:  729,239

FEMALE VOTERS:  704,661

TOTAL ASSEMBLIES:  10 

JORHAT, TITABAR, MARIANI, TEOK, AMGURI, NAZIRA, MAHMARA, SONARI, THOWRA, SIBSAGAR
